@import "https://fonts.googleapis.com/css2?family=DM+Serif+Display:ital@0;1&family=DM+Sans:opsz,wght@9..40,300;9..40,400;9..40,500;9..40,600&display=swap";.stump-page{background:#f5f2ec;width:100%;font-family:DM Sans,sans-serif}.stump-tag{letter-spacing:3px;text-transform:uppercase;color:#6b9e3a;margin-bottom:14px;font-size:10px;font-weight:600;display:block}.stump-hero{box-sizing:border-box;grid-template-columns:1.1fr .9fr;align-items:center;gap:60px;width:100%;max-width:1300px;margin:0 auto;padding:90px 6%;display:grid}.stump-hero-content h1{color:#0d2818;margin-bottom:16px;font-family:DM Serif Display,serif;font-size:3.2rem;font-weight:400;line-height:1.08}.stump-tagline{color:#6b9e3a;margin-bottom:20px;font-family:DM Serif Display,serif;font-size:1.1rem;font-style:italic}.stump-desc{color:#666;max-width:540px;margin-bottom:28px;font-size:.92rem;line-height:1.85}.stump-trust-row{flex-wrap:wrap;gap:10px 24px;margin-bottom:36px;display:flex}.stump-trust-row span{color:#0d2818;font-size:.82rem;font-weight:600}.stump-hero-btns{flex-wrap:wrap;gap:14px;display:flex}.stump-btn-primary{color:#fff;background:#6b9e3a;border-radius:12px;align-items:center;gap:8px;padding:15px 26px;font-size:14px;font-weight:600;text-decoration:none;transition:background .25s,transform .25s;display:inline-flex;box-shadow:0 6px 20px #6b9e3a40}.stump-btn-primary:hover{background:#3d6b1a;transform:translateY(-2px)}.stump-btn-secondary{color:#0d2818;background:#fff;border:1.5px solid #e8e4dc;border-radius:12px;align-items:center;gap:8px;padding:15px 26px;font-size:14px;font-weight:600;text-decoration:none;transition:border-color .25s,transform .25s;display:inline-flex}.stump-btn-secondary:hover{border-color:#6b9e3a;transform:translateY(-2px)}.stump-hero-img{border-radius:24px;height:520px;overflow:hidden;box-shadow:0 20px 60px #0d28181f}.stump-hero-img img{object-fit:cover;object-position:center;width:100%;height:100%}.stump-benefits-bar{box-sizing:border-box;background:#fff;grid-template-columns:repeat(4,1fr);gap:32px;width:100%;max-width:1300px;margin:0 auto;padding:48px 6%;display:grid}.stump-benefit{align-items:flex-start;gap:16px;display:flex}.stump-benefit-icon{background:#f0f7e8;border:1.5px solid #d4e9bf;border-radius:12px;flex-shrink:0;justify-content:center;align-items:center;width:44px;height:44px;display:flex}.stump-benefit-icon svg{color:#6b9e3a;font-size:1rem}.stump-benefit h4{color:#0d2818;margin-bottom:6px;font-family:DM Serif Display,serif;font-size:.95rem;font-weight:400;line-height:1.3}.stump-benefit p{color:#777;font-size:.8rem;line-height:1.6}.stump-why{background:#f5f2ec;width:100%;padding:80px 6%}.stump-why-inner{grid-template-columns:1fr 1fr;align-items:start;gap:60px;max-width:1200px;margin:0 auto;display:grid}.stump-why-left h2{color:#0d2818;margin-bottom:20px;font-family:DM Serif Display,serif;font-size:2.2rem;font-weight:400;line-height:1.1}.stump-why-desc{color:#666;margin-bottom:28px;font-size:.88rem;line-height:1.85}.stump-check-list{flex-direction:column;gap:12px;padding:0;list-style:none;display:flex}.stump-check-list li{color:#555;align-items:flex-start;gap:12px;font-size:.86rem;line-height:1.6;display:flex}.stump-check-list li svg{color:#6b9e3a;flex-shrink:0;margin-top:2px;font-size:14px}.stump-what-card{background:#fff;border:1.5px solid #e8e4dc;border-radius:22px;padding:36px 32px}.stump-what-card h3{color:#0d2818;margin-bottom:28px;font-family:DM Serif Display,serif;font-size:1.1rem;font-weight:400;line-height:1.55}.stump-process{background:#fff;width:100%;padding:80px 6%}.stump-process-inner{grid-template-columns:1fr 1fr;align-items:start;gap:80px;max-width:1200px;margin:0 auto;display:grid}.stump-process-left h2,.stump-process-right h2{color:#0d2818;margin-bottom:36px;font-family:DM Serif Display,serif;font-size:2rem;font-weight:400;line-height:1.15}.stump-steps-vertical{flex-direction:column;display:flex}.stump-step-vertical{align-items:flex-start;gap:20px;display:flex}.stump-step-num-v{color:#d4e9bf;flex-shrink:0;width:48px;font-family:DM Serif Display,serif;font-size:1.8rem;font-weight:400;line-height:1}.stump-step-vertical h4{color:#0d2818;margin-bottom:6px;font-family:DM Serif Display,serif;font-size:1rem;font-weight:400;line-height:1.3}.stump-step-vertical p{color:#777;font-size:.82rem;line-height:1.75}.stump-step-arrow{color:#d4e9bf;justify-content:flex-start;margin:10px 0;padding-left:14px;font-size:.9rem;display:flex}.stump-equipment-desc{color:#666;margin-bottom:28px;font-size:.88rem;line-height:1.85}.stump-section-header{text-align:center;margin-bottom:48px}.stump-section-header h2{color:#0d2818;font-family:DM Serif Display,serif;font-size:2.4rem;font-weight:400;line-height:1.1}.stump-where{background:#f5f2ec;width:100%;padding:80px 6%}.stump-where-grid{grid-template-columns:repeat(6,1fr);gap:16px;max-width:1200px;margin:0 auto;display:grid}.stump-where-card{text-align:center;background:#fff;border:1.5px solid #e8e4dc;border-radius:16px;flex-direction:column;align-items:center;gap:12px;padding:24px 16px;transition:all .3s;display:flex}.stump-where-card:hover{border-color:#d4e9bf;transform:translateY(-4px);box-shadow:0 8px 24px #0d28180f}.stump-where-icon{background:#f0f7e8;border:1.5px solid #d4e9bf;border-radius:12px;justify-content:center;align-items:center;width:44px;height:44px;display:flex}.stump-where-icon svg{color:#6b9e3a;font-size:1rem}.stump-where-card span{color:#0d2818;font-size:.8rem;font-weight:600;line-height:1.4}.stump-faq{background:#fff;width:100%;padding:80px 6%}.stump-faq-grid{grid-template-columns:repeat(3,1fr);gap:20px;max-width:1200px;margin:0 auto;display:grid}.stump-faq-item{background:#f5f2ec;border:1.5px solid #e8e4dc;border-radius:18px;padding:26px 24px;transition:border-color .25s,box-shadow .25s}.stump-faq-item:hover{border-color:#d4e9bf;box-shadow:0 6px 20px #0d28180d}.stump-faq-item h4{color:#0d2818;margin-bottom:10px;font-family:DM Serif Display,serif;font-size:1rem;font-weight:400;line-height:1.4}.stump-faq-item p{color:#777;font-size:.82rem;line-height:1.75}@media (width<=1200px){.stump-where-grid{grid-template-columns:repeat(3,1fr)}.stump-faq-grid{grid-template-columns:repeat(2,1fr)}}@media (width<=768px){.stump-hero{grid-template-columns:1fr;gap:40px;padding:60px 5%}.stump-hero-content h1{font-size:2.4rem}.stump-hero-img{height:320px}.stump-benefits-bar{grid-template-columns:1fr 1fr;padding:40px 5%}.stump-why{padding:60px 5%}.stump-why-inner{grid-template-columns:1fr;gap:32px}.stump-process{padding:60px 5%}.stump-process-inner{grid-template-columns:1fr;gap:48px}.stump-where{padding:60px 5%}.stump-where-grid{grid-template-columns:repeat(2,1fr)}.stump-faq{padding:60px 5%}.stump-faq-grid{grid-template-columns:1fr}.stump-hero-btns{flex-direction:column}.stump-btn-primary,.stump-btn-secondary{justify-content:center}.stump-section-header h2{font-size:2rem}}
